1950, Enforcement of the selective service law
Enforcement of the selective service system by Earl L. Kirchner, xi+339p., Washington, D.C., U.S. Government Printing Office, 1951. ( Monograph
Number 14 in a special Selective Service series that discusses the enforcement of the Selective Training and Service Act of 1940. It deals with the
relationship of the Selective Service to the Department of Justice, historical antecedents, and lessons for the future. This work is intended as a companion
to Special Monograph No.2, "The Selective Service Act." A detailed Table of Contents begins on p.v and a subject index begins on p.335.)
